Baby fence lizard questions.

T1tanrush Jul 02, 2009 10:56 PM

I have about an inch long fence lizard I captured about a week ago, have him set up in a small rubbermaid with dirt and some sticks. I have the top cut open with a screen put in for ventilation and whatnot.
Is this a suitable setup for him? I haven't observed him eating yet I'm only now trying to figure him out. I'm more used to decent sized babies than something this small and picky. Any suggestions?

Do you have the baby lizard under UVB lights? They need that so as not to develop metabolic bone disease. They also need a dish of water. You will have to find the tiniest crickets for this little guy. Could probably get some wingless Drosophila hydrei (the larger species) fruit flies, too. Keep him at about 85 degrees, and provide him a temperature gradient, so he can pick where he wants to be. He will also appreciate a small hide box.
